Ordinals
beta
Address bc1p0mamfdykg4kzrx3wt9u5tedyt93nrnmpcwqsj5lrj4rhlagtgfeq40g5qz
sat balance
536225
runes balances
outputs
316520602b4811695326e867fe62b03f525287c426247eedeb603d01ce14f4e9:0